OpenSpace3D 1.93 Beta

The new OpenSpace3D 1.93 Beta is available for tests

It include:
- new normal map and Roughness/Metalness texture editor in the material editor
- Chat GPT plugit, you will need a Chat GPT API key
- Path finding plugITs including navigation mesh, simple pathfinding and crowd plugITs
- The video plugIT can now display control bar in the video content.
- UI plugITs now can have a fade in / fade out animation
- Draw plugIT allow to fill an area and manage better the mouse In/Out in the content

Re: OpenSpace3D 1.93 Beta

Hello,

yes you can use passthrough feature on Quest2 Quest3 and Pico4
still since we cannot access the camera stream directly we can't detect markers in scene.

Re: OpenSpace3D 1.93 Beta

Hello,

I'm working on several improvements, but not yet on instantiate or decal.
I have no specific date for beta 2 but it will come when I have a stable version o current developements.

What coming next is,
- subtitle plugit, that compute input text in a timed text
- log file plugit that allow to save input text into a log file
- some update on ChatGPT plugIT
- Quad buffer stereo working again.
- Some improvement on the VRPN plugIT
- improvements on speech recognition on android and windows
